当前位置:首页 » 存储配置 » reactless如何配置

reactless如何配置

发布时间: 2022-07-20 02:27:55

⑴ react中使用less样式怎么设置对当前页面有效

看帮助文档去,很多的

⑵ webstrom自动编译less文件路径怎么配置的


  1. 安装nodejs,

  2. 打开CMD命令行工具,windows+R ==>输入cmd回车

  3. 输入代码: npm install -g less回车执行,就会安装less工具

  4. 打开webStorm, File-->Settings-->Tools-->FileWatchers

  5. 右边有一列,找到一个"+"号的图标,点击,选中里面的"less",看看是不是和下图一样,不同版本的WebStorm可能会有区别,这个是WebStorm 2016.1的版本截图

  6. 点击"OK",应该就可以了

⑶ react 服务端渲染怎么处理less文件

有些回答中提到CPU负载和node.js效率问题。服务器端渲染固然耗CPU,但可以使用服务器端缓存的方式解决,并不是每个用户访问都需要重新渲染一遍。而且服务器端渲染甚至可以潜在地增加服务器效率(这点在参考资料第二个里有提到,不过是纯英文的,...

⑷ react-app-rewired一个react项目本来好好的,可安装,配置上这个依赖后之前的le

摘要 你好react-app-rewired' 不是内部或外部命令,也不是可运行的程序 ,所以有问题。

⑸ 用react-create-app 怎么引入 less 开发

我尝试过这个 ,但是后面发现安装less-loader less模块的时候, 一运行 npm start 就报错

⑹ react 中怎么可以根据不同的条件引入不同的less

我的方法是把inline styles写在一个文件里,用一个grunt或者gulp task把这个文件编译进共享的mole里

⑺ 怎么在webstrom配置less环境

1.在chrome中开启dev工具,开启容许CSS source maps设置

2.webstorm中只要创建了less扩展名的文件,就会有提示只要你同意就会创建一个firewatchers任务,但是这个默认的任务只能编译出css。我们需要对这个任务进行一些小小的修改,以便能达到产出sourcemap。

原版配置

改造后的配置

3.对Arguments 和Output paths to refresh这两项进行了修改
Arguments

1

--no-color --source-map=$FileNameWithoutExtension$.css.map $FileName$

Output paths to refresh

1

$FileNameWithoutExtension$.css:$FileNameWithoutExtension$.css.map

这样就能够既产出.css文件又能产出.map文件了

产出的对应的map文件为

1

{"version":3,"sources":["app.less"],"names":[],"mappings":"AAAG;EACF,YAAA;;AAEE;EACA,aAAA;;AAEE;EACJ,UAAA;EACA,eAAA;EACA,iBAAA"}

是不是很棒呢,经过简单设置就可以快乐开发了!
4.修改命令的依据是

1

lessc app.less app.css --source-map=app.css.map

⑻ Mac笔记本的webstorm如何配置less文件,可以修改less文件的时候让他自动生成css文件

安装nodejs
打开CMD命令行工具,
windows+R ==> 输入 cmd 回车
输入代码: npm install -g less 回车执行, 就会安装less工具
打开webStorm, File-->Settings-->Tools-->File Watchers
右边有一列, 找到一个"+"号的图标, 点击, 选中里面的"less"
点击"OK", 应该就可以了。

⑼ react中怎么设置在触发某个事件的时候组件发生样式的改变

React的组件式开发,让我们可以利用其ComponentModel,专注于单个组件的逻辑开发,其中还包括组织组件的样式。先声明,本文并不是webpack配置教程,不会介绍详细的配置过程,假设你们已经用过了css-loaderstyle-loaderextract-text-webpack-plugin。正在使用的方式我们理想中的文件结构可能会是这样的:-components-modal-modal.jsx-modal.css//可以是任意预处理器-dropdown-dropdown.jsx-dropdown.css然而,js现在可以做模块化,css并不行,所有css的定义都可以被视为全局变量,在css被打包后,一个组件的样式有可能会影响到其他组件,于是我们可以通过命名约定(nameconvention)来曲线救国(这一点并不局限于react开发)。@modal-prefix:modal;.@{modal-prefix}{}.@{modal-prefix}-title{}类似于上面的使用less的方式,在文件顶部先定义个类的前缀,来尽量避免命名冲突的可能。于是在组件中就可以这样做importReactfrom'react';import'./modal.less';exportdefaultReact.createClass({render(){returnHello;}});上面就是我现在在用的方式,利用命名约定做到了伪模块化(其实即便不是在使用react开发项目,也会用类似的方式)。CSSinJS之前看到过一个ppt:/css-moles/webpack-demo写在最后的话目前的探索结果暂时是这样,之后可能会继续来填坑。反正现在应该不会去用CSSinJS,CSSMoles可以一试,因为css-loader这个插件基本react的项目里都会使用,写好的组件一个import,样式和组件都有了,不过仍需实践。

⑽ 如何在webstorm中配置less

安装nodejs, nodejs.org/ 打开CMD命令行工具, windows+R ==> 输入 cmd 回车 输入代码: npm install -g less 回车执行, 就会安装less工具 打开webStorm, File-->Settings-->Tools-->File Watchers 右边有一列, 找到一个"+"号的图标, 点击,。

热点内容
缓存区数据读写原理 发布:2025-05-15 03:39:57 浏览:585
编译器生成的是二进制文件吗 发布:2025-05-15 03:38:42 浏览:955
运营为什么区分ios和安卓 发布:2025-05-15 03:30:02 浏览:630
主播网站源码 发布:2025-05-15 02:50:56 浏览:168
中文编程语言有哪些 发布:2025-05-15 02:48:59 浏览:536
配置中心应急流程有哪些 发布:2025-05-15 02:37:31 浏览:670
php宏定义 发布:2025-05-15 02:32:54 浏览:271
咸鱼支付密码哪里改 发布:2025-05-15 02:32:53 浏览:521
存储机箱 发布:2025-05-15 02:31:31 浏览:837
编程很累吗 发布:2025-05-15 02:29:25 浏览:553